<p>Trendsetters is a mid-sized retail company focusing on fashion apparel with numerous brick-and-mortar areas and an e-commerce platform. Despite having a wealth of data from sales deals, client feedback, and stock management, the company had a hard time to derive significant insights due to an absence of cohesive data visualization strategies. Key stakeholders spent excessive time manually compiling reports and identifying trends, causing hold-ups in strategic decision-making and missed market opportunities.</p>
<p><strong>Identifying the Challenge</strong></p>
<p>Trendsetters dealt with several vital challenges:</p>
<p></p><ol> <li><strong>Data Silos</strong>: Information existed across several platforms, consisting of point-of-sale (POS) systems, web analytics, and inventory management software. Data was not integrated, causing inconsistencies and problems in analysis.</li> 
</ol>
<ol> <li><strong>Lack of Real-Time Insights</strong>: Key efficiency indications (KPIs) were not readily available, making it difficult for management to make prompt choices.</li> 
</ol>
<ol> <li><strong>Powerful, Yet Underutilized Data</strong>: With analytical tools readily available, the team still found it frustrating to draw out insights due to complicated interfaces and improperly developed reports.</li> 
</ol>

<p><strong>Phase One: Needs Assessment</strong></p>
<p>Data Visionaries conducted a series of workshops including stakeholders at different organizational levels. They intended to comprehend the decision-making processes, identify vital KPIs, and evaluate the desired data outputs for different departments, consisting of sales, marketing, and stock management.</p>
<p>Some of the recognized KPIs included:</p>
<p></p><ul> <li>Daily and weekly sales figures by product classification</li> 
 <li>Customer acquisition expenses and conversion rates</li> 
 <li>Inventory turnover and stock levels</li> 
 <li>Customer retention rates and commitment program engagement</li> 
</ul>
<strong>Phase 2: Designing the Dashboard</strong>
<p>With the KPIs established, the next step was to develop an intuitive, user-friendly control panel. Data Visionaries used a design believing technique, making sure that the dashboard aligned with the end-users' requirements. This included:</p>
<p></p><ul> <li><strong>Wireframing</strong>: Initial wireframes illustrated the design, making it possible for stakeholders to provide feedback on the design components and performance.</li> 
 <li><strong>Data Combination</strong>: Dealing with Trendsetters' IT team, Data Visionaries implemented an automated data combination service, combining data from disparate systems into a central database.</li> 
 <li><strong>Visual Design</strong>: The dashboard adopted a visually enticing layout, using charts, charts, and color-coded signals to improve comprehension. They made sure all components were lined up with the business's branding.</li> 
</ul>
